Soda Ash Light (sodium carbonate, light form) serves as one of the most critical building blocks within global basic chemical industries. Characterized by its lower bulk density (typically 0.50 to 0.65 g/cm³) compared to its dense counterpart, Soda Ash Light is preferred in processes requiring rapid dissolution kinetics and uniform chemical reactions. On a global scale, the demand for high-purity Soda Ash Light remains robust, heavily driven by the detergent, chemical processing, metallurgy, and water treatment sectors.
Currently, the global supply structure of Soda Ash Light is anchored on three main production methodologies: the Solvay Process (ammonia-soda process), the Hou Process (combined soda process), and natural trona ore refinement. The choice of process impacts not only the cost curve but also the micro-structural impurities (such as chloride and iron levels) of the finished product. Under the pressure of global carbon neutrality mandates, the alkali chemical manufacturing industry is undergoing a radical transition. Traditional Solvay synthesis is energy-intensive and produces significant carbon dioxide byproducts. Leading players are now investing in CCU (Carbon Capture & Utilization) integration, where recaptured flue gases are repurposed to feed the carbonation tower in the production of light sodium carbonate.
Furthermore, supply chain resilience has become a paramount concern. Importers are moving away from spot-market reliance and shifting toward long-term OEM contracts with accredited plants that hold extensive chemical infrastructure, raw brine access, and logistical access to international ports.

Understanding the exact chemical variations between light and dense soda ash for optimal industrial process design.
For industrial procurement officers and process designers, choosing between light and dense soda ash is a matter of process physics. While they share the same chemical formula ($Na_2CO_3$), their physical characteristics dictate their final application efficiency.
| Parameter | Soda Ash Light (Specification) | Soda Ash Dense (Specification) | Analytical Method / Impact |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bulk Density (g/cm³) | 0.50 – 0.65 | 0.90 – 1.20 | ASTM D1895 (Determines packing/storage volume) |
| Particle Size (average) | < 150 μm (Fine powder) | 300 – 1000 μm (Granular) | Sieve Shaker Analysis (Controls dust & flowability) |
| Dissolution Kinetics | Very High (< 2 minutes) | Moderate (Requires heating/agitation) | Dynamic dissolution tracking at 25°C |
| Total Alkalinity (as Na₂CO₃) | 99.2% Min | 99.2% Min | Acid-base titration against standard HCl |
| Sulfate (as SO₄²⁻) | 0.08% Max | 0.08% Max | Spectrophotometric impurity control |
| Iron Content (Fe) | 0.003% Max (30 ppm) | 0.0035% Max (35 ppm) | ICP-OES analysis for color-sensitive formulations |

How downstream engineering teams utilize light sodium carbonate to drive efficiency and meet regulatory compliance.
In localized laundry and cleaning compound industries, Soda Ash Light works as a builder. It buffers pH levels to optimize surfactant efficiency and precipitates hard water ions (Calcium and Magnesium). The rapid solubility of the light grade ensures that dry powder formulations dissolve instantly in residential washing systems, preventing residues on fabrics.
Municipal and industrial effluent treatment facilities use light sodium carbonate to neutralize acidic wastewater, adjust pH, and precipitate heavy metals. Its high reactivity makes it a preferred choice over lime or caustic soda, offering safer handling parameters, reduced sludge volume, and more precise dosage control.
Soda Ash Light is the starting point for producing diverse sodium salts, sodium phosphates, and sodium silicates (such as our proprietary JZ-DSS-P series). Its high chemical reactivity enables rapid synthesis in rotary furnaces or autoclave processes, ensuring uniform yield and lower process temperatures.
Mining operations rely on Soda Ash Light to maintain the pH balance of mineral pulp during froth flotation of non-ferrous metals. It functions as a modifying agent to depress iron sulfides while promoting copper, lead, or zinc recovery, drastically improving ore enrichment yields.

While dense soda ash is typically preferred for flat glass manufacturing to prevent dust carrying in furnace drafts, light soda ash is widely used in specialty glass and container glass formulations where quick dissolution and fine mixing are required.
